Top-4 DDA for a C18 separation leading to 631 differential metabolites? I do 2 complementary HILIC runs, top-15 DDA, and 600 _metabolites_ (not differential) is a 99th percentile result. I guess some of these annotations come from MS1 matching at that super generous 30 ppm allowable error?
